Here’s a quick rundown of the sections in the course:

  • Section 100: Course Introduction (3 lessons)
  • Section 101: Date and Time Basics (7 lessons)
  • Section 102: Working with Date and Time Functions (5 lessons)
  • Section 103: Calculating with Dates (6 lessons)
  • Section 104: Calculating with Times (4 lessons)
  • Section 105: Converting Dates and Times (4 lessons)
  • Section 106: Formatting Dates and Times (4 lessons)
  • Section 107: Wrapping Up (2 lessons)
